WebAug 14, 2024 · 1. Choose the right size paper clip for the number of wires you have. 2. Put a screw with a small washer in the middle of one of the handles of the clip, attaching it to the bottom side of the desk, wall, shelf or etc. 3. Push on the other chrome handle and the clip will open.
